WHAT YOU'LL DO:

- Build and scale Sierra's performance marketing function by defining and executing the strategy that turns paid spend into pipeline. Own paid search and paid social end-to-end, including channel strategy, campaign execution, and the systems needed to scale.

- Own pipeline and budget performance, managing a quarterly pipeline target and multi-million-dollar advertising budget. Make data-driven investment decisions and use forecasting, attribution, and reporting to optimize efficiency and demonstrate ROI.

- Lead strategy through execution, defining account and persona targeting, messaging, and competitive positioning while also building campaigns, optimizing bids, allocating budget, and developing high-performing ad copy and creative.

- Drive a culture of rapid experimentation by continuously testing audiences, messaging, creative, channels, and campaign strategies. Quickly identify what works, double down on successful initiatives, and iterate away from underperforming tactics.

- Leverage AI to multiply impact, automating meaningful aspects of the marketing workflow to increase speed, scale experimentation, and expand the team's reach beyond what a traditional performance marketing function could achieve.

- You'll partner closely with Sales, Marketing, Marketing/Revenue Ops, and Customer & Product Marketing to align on target accounts, messaging, campaigns, data, attribution, and pipeline performance, while reporting into marketing leadership with the autonomy to set strategy and the visibility to drive measurable business impact.

WHAT YOU'LL BRING:

- 7–10 years of B2B performance marketing experience with deep, hands-on ownership of paid search and paid social, including expert-level proficiency across Google Ads, Microsoft/Bing Ads, LinkedIn Ads, and Meta/Facebook Ads.

- Proven success owning pipeline and budget performance, managing multi-million-dollar quarterly ad budgets, maximizing ROAS, partnering closely with Sales in a sales-led motion, and using attribution, forecasting, and marketing operations to connect spend to pipeline and revenue.

- Strong strategic and executional capabilities, with the ability to develop account and persona targeting, messaging, and competitive positioning while also executing campaign structure, platform optimization, bid strategy, budget allocation, copy, and creative.

- A data-driven operator with a bias for experimentation, who treats every campaign as a learning opportunity, translates complex data into actionable insights, and continuously optimizes performance based on results.

- A self-starter who thrives in fast-paced, high-growth environments, embraces ambiguity, is excited by AI and its applications to marketing, and is motivated by building scalable programs and processes from the ground up.

EVEN BETTER...

- Hands-on experience with modern GTM tooling, including Clay and data enrichment platforms, along with experience executing ABM strategies for high-ACV, named-account sales motions.

- Experience marketing technical or AI products to sophisticated B2B buyers, with a strong point of view on measurement and attribution in a privacy-first, post-cookie world.

- A relentless experimentation mindset, with a constant backlog of ideas to test and optimize, always looking for new ways to improve targeting, performance, and growth..
